
No fewer than 8,000 members of the All Progressives Congress, APC, have
defected to the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, in Benue State.
Among those who defected was the lawmaker representing Gwer West/East in the National Assembly, Mark Gbillah.
Speaking on behalf of those defecting in Naka, Gwer West Local
Government Area of the State, yesterday, Gbillah said they left APC
after consulting with major stakeholders in the constituency.
He said, “This is the axis that herdsmen ravaged the most in our state apart from Makurdi, Guma and Logo Local Government areas.
“Our people were killed and chased away from their communities and
ancestral homes and the Federal Government feigned ignorance, despite
the cries of every one of us, including Governor Samuel Ortom.
“So over 8,000 of us are leaving the party and more will be leaving
in the coming days as the train moves to other areas of my constituency
and Gwer East.”
